Your Opportunity: Taylor Print & Service Solutions, a division of Taylor Corporation, is looking for a local Sales Account Manager to join our team to help support a book of clients.
Your Responsibilities:
  • Ensure that organizational goods or services consistently meet client needs while achieving and exceeding performance objectives
  • Resolve customer issues/problems; research and make recommendations for potential product enhancements or modifications to increase sales
  • Partner with CS team for quoting and order management responsibilities
  • Broaden client relationships thru contact expansion/referrals for potential growth opportunities
  • Proactively communicating technology updates, usage, and ensuring adoption for the customer
  • Responsible for managing inventory reports & reorders to ensure client does not run out of product
  • Schedule and participate in client business reviews
You Must Have:
  • A minimum of a bachelors' degree or its equivalent with more than 2 years of experience in Sales or in related area or sales aptitude
  • A self-starter mentality and the ability to operate within an organization independently
  • Relentless attitudes towards growth - strong desire to champion double digit growth
  • Effectiveness in building strategic relationships internally/externally
  • An entrepreneur attitude with relentless pursuit of new business
  • Effective client/market planning and consultative selling skills
  • Ability to create interest and open doors through multiple business development strategies
  • Ability to develop strategic relationships with clients and partners
  • Ability to understand client challenges/objectives and align capabilities to deliver a high value proposition
  • Effective skills in making presentations, performing negotiations, and closing business

About Taylor Corporation
One of the largest graphics communications firms in North America, Taylor's family of companies provide a diverse set of products, services and technologies addressing the toughest communication challenges. For nearly 50 years, Taylor has been a premier provider of powerful and innovative products, services and expertise for individuals, businesses and distributors large and small. Our 10,000+ employees spanning 26 states and seven countries work diligently to create the interactive, printing and marketing solutions that have helped build some of the world's more recognizable brands.
